: In ancient Sumer, Ninkasi was the revered goddess of beer and brewing. A famous hymn, dating back to 1800 BCE, serves as both a song of praise and a practical brewing recipe. Beer, under Ninkasi's patronage, was a source of healing and community, enjoyed by both gods and mortals. The name "Ninkasi" itself appears in modern craft brewing, linking ancient reverence with contemporary practice.
